Robloxhas hit a surprising milestone, accumulating more users than the entire population of people in the world. TheRobloxachievement is one that’s taken some fans by surprise, but also indicates just how popular the game really is.
Robloxhas managed to remain an extremely popular gamenearly 20 years after its original release. The title’s popularity has likely been due in large part to the fact that the platform has spawned an endless number of games to play, with many built and created from the ground up by the fans and users themselves.
Now, one of thoseRobloxgameshas revealed that the overall number of user accounts on the platform is now higher than that the world population. To be precise, the number given was 8,228,760,226, while the human population of the world is estimated to be at 8,214,500,000 people at time of publication. The data is courtesy of aRobloxgame called New User Machine that tabulates the number of user accounts that have joined the service. The game estimated thatRobloxwould reach 8.229 billion users within 40 minutes of the screenshot being taken, so it’s likely that it’s risen even further by now.
How Does Roblox Have More User Than the World Population?
As fans have pointed out, while this is quite the achievement forRoblox, it doesn’t mean that all of these user accounts are valid or in use. New User Machine counts user accounts that joinRoblox, but that doesn’t mean that every account is still in use or ever was. Users have speculated that a good chunk of the accounts could belong to bots, and that many could also be alts. The count also includes terminated accounts.
With that said, even with terminated accounts, bots, and alts taken into consideration, there’s no argument that this is still an incredible number forRobloxto have reached. For comparison’s sake, mobile games likePUBG,Call of Duty, andAmong Ushave seen hundreds of millions of downloads and/or players, whileMinecraftandGrand Theft Auto 5have sold hundreds of millions of copieseach. These numbers are incredible in their own right, but the sheer difference is staggering.
Robloxhas previously been accused of inflating player counts, which the company refuted. While this new statistic doesn’t tell the full story,Robloxhas done something that few online services and platforms, let alone games, can claim.
